Motion by Alan E. Kudisch for reinstatement to the Bar as an attorney and counselor-at-law. Mr. Kudisch was admitted to the Bar at a term of the Appellate Division of the Supreme Court in the Third Judicial Department on February 18, 1976. By decision and order on application of this Court dated April 14, 2000, the Grievance Committee for the Second, Eleventh, and Thirteenth Judicial Districts was authorized to institute and prosecute a disciplinary proceeding against Mr. Kudisch, and the issues raised were referred to the Honorable Francis X. Egitto, as Special Referee to hear and report. By opinion and order of this Court dated December 10, 2001, as amended January 7, 2002, Mr. Kudsich was suspended from the practice of law for a period of two years, commencing February 7, 2002, based upon four charges of professional misconduct.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in relation thereto, it is

ORDERED that the motion is held in abeyance and the matter is referred to the Committee on Character and Fitness to investigate and report on Mr. Kudisch's fitness to be an attorney.
